Zoologist Salary in Springfield, Massachusetts
The median zoologist salary in Springfield, MA is $66,865 per year, which is 2% below the national median and 27.4% below the Massachusetts state average.

Zoologist Salary in Springfield by Experience
In Springfield, an entry-level zoologist earns around $44,100, while experienced professionals earn up to $102,900 per year. The local cost of living index is 98% of the national average.
